Reasons To Add Activated Charcoal To Your Beauty Regimen-

  • An All-Natural Ingredient
  • Antibacterial and Anti-fungal Properties
  • Unclogs Pores
  • Balances Oily Skin
  • Gently Exfoliates

Activated charcoal draws bacteria, poisons, chemicals, dirt and other micro-particles to the surface of the skin, helping you to achieve a flawless complexion and fight acne. Charcoal is not metabolized, adsorbed or absorbed by the body, but it can be used to treat some poisonous bites and disinfect some wounds. Activated charcoal powder is proven to adsorb thousands of times its own mass in harmful substances, which makes it a popular ingredient in facial masks.

The Benefits Algae Bring To Your Skin:

Algae come with some caveats, as do all beauty product ingredient claims. “There’s enough science here to say that algae, seaweed and kelp may provide some benefits but of course it depends on the specific type of extract, how it’s processed, and how much is used,” Schueller cautioned.

In general, algae are known to contain:

  • Protein and amino acids, up to 60% protein by dry weight
  • Vitamins A (beta-carotene), C (ascorbic acid), E and K

Many of the B-complex vitamins, including B1 (thiamine), B2 (riboflavin), B6 (pyridoxine), choline, biotin, niacin, folic acid, pantothenic acid and B12 (cobalamin)

Minerals and trace minerals, including iodine, calcium, chloride, chromium, copper, iron, magnesium, manganese, potassium, phosphorus, sodium and zinc

  • Omega-3 fatty acids, including EPA, DHA, GLA and ALA
  • Active enzymes
  • Phytochemicals like chlorophyll, fucoxanthin and other plant pigments.
